<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                企業??AI智能體構建引擎,智能編排和調試,一鍵部署,支持知識庫和私有化部署方案 廣告
                ## 一、概述 binlog(二進制日志),記錄對數據發生或潛在發生更改的SQL語句,并以二進制形式保存在磁盤; 主要作用:備份和復制(主從服務器); ## 二、常用命令 ### **查詢當前 MySQL 是否支持 binlog** ``` mysql> show variables like 'log_bin'; ``` ![](https://img.kancloud.cn/57/d3/57d3d61e57bdf651a8040939a7b3235f_1045x128.png) ### **配置** ``` [mysqld] log-bin=mysql-bin #開啟binlog binlog-expire-logs-seconds= 259200 # 只保留3天的日志文件 binlog-format=ROW ``` >[danger] mysql8.0.11以后的版本開始,默認開啟; ### **查看所有Binlog的日志列表** ``` mysql> show master logs; ``` ![](https://img.kancloud.cn/8e/c9/8ec970fa66cb592e2ccf188a22f2b27e_1050x167.png) ### **查看binlog日志狀態** ``` mysql> show master status; ``` ![](https://img.kancloud.cn/95/46/9546966301408687de9f8cc367460491_1045x150.png) ### **查看指定的Binlog日志** ``` mysql>show binlog events in 'binlog.000001'; ``` ### **查看Binlog日志保存時長** ``` mysql> show variables like 'expire_logs_days'; ``` ![](https://img.kancloud.cn/6b/70/6b70c02e976572ac109eb754d0121fb5_1047x144.png) ### **設置Binlog日志保存時長** ``` [mysqld] expire_logs_days = 7 # 只保留 7 天的日志文件 ``` ### **刪除指定日期以前的日志索引中binlog日志文件** ``` mysql> purge master logs before '2021-07-01 12:00:00'; ``` > 1、主從結構的,不能隨意刪除,因為主從數據同步依賴binlog,如果是單機,可以刪除,單機已測試過; > 2、在磁盤滿了的情況下執行是不會成功的、這個時候要先從磁盤中刪除一部分無用的二進制日志、然后再清理; ### **清空所有 binlog 文件** ``` mysql> reset master; ``` > 1、主從結構的,不能隨意刪除,因為主從數據同步依賴binlog,如果是單機,可以刪除,單機已測試過; > 2、在磁盤滿了的情況下執行是不會成功的、這個時候要先從磁盤中刪除一部分無用的二進制日志、然后再清理; > 3、如果實在沒有空間了,可以停止MySQL服務(嘗試),然后把binlog移走,同時更新mysql-bin.index文件,將移走的binlog名字從這里刪除,然后重啟服務;
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看